Best answer to the question Ā«Can cat hair change color after being shaved?Ā»
Itās possible for your catās fur to change color when it grows back after being shaved. Over time, your cat will normally revert back to their original color, but the initial regrowth could be a different color as suddenly your catās body is a lot cooler, which affects the shade of the fur. Can a catās hair change color after it is shaved?A catās hair can change color after it has been shaved. This has been reported by other cat owners, for example, a black cat being shaved and the fur returning light grey or white. Many assume because their skin pigment determines the fur color this canāt happen, but itās possible. So, now you know. But, is it bad to shave them?
Will my Siamese cat change color after being shaved?
You should also be prepared to see coat color changes if your Siamese cat is shaved for any medical or surgical procedures. Afterward, that first hair re-growth will occur on less insulated, cooler skin so there will likely be a darker patch, but then the next cycle should bring back the lighter, āoriginalā color.

Why is my catās fur getting darker after being shaved?
Thatās because when shaved, your catās body is cooler, which causes the color of the fur to darken as itās growing. Itās the same reason that the points ā the coolest parts of your catās body ā are darker. Over time, the fur closest to their skin will start to revert to their original lighter color, but this can take a while.

Why is my cat's hair losing color?
Tumors, cysts, inflammation, hormonal imbalances, jaundice and diseases like Cushing's disease can all cause the fur to change color, so monitor your cat's behavior and general well being when you see him changing shades. Why do cat paw pads change color?
A change to a catās paw pad color can be due to a medical problem. The most common reason why paw pads change color is injury. This could be due to stepping on a sharp piece of glass, being bitten by an insect, burns, and ingrown claws. Other reasons for sudden changes in paw pad color include vitiligo, plasma cell pododermatitis, and anemia.
